请教:关于单片机P0口

[复制链接]
2869|9
 楼主| haysion 发表于 2007-9-13 16:14 | 显示全部楼层 |阅读模式
    程序初始化时将P0口置高,然后不对P0口进行任何操作,P0口直接接地为什么不会产生大电流?
maychang 发表于 2007-9-13 16:16 | 显示全部楼层

51单片机P0口内部没有上拉电阻

短路到地没有电流输出。
其它口短路到地电流也很小。
mhl201 发表于 2007-9-13 16:17 | 显示全部楼层

逛逛

外部电平影响.P0口接地后变为低电平.对不
lypd96 发表于 2007-9-13 16:20 | 显示全部楼层

RE:

P0口直接接地不会产生大电流
CONWH 发表于 2007-9-13 16:32 | 显示全部楼层

因为它不是标准意义的推挽式工作方式,在输出“1”时也有

的内部电阻,故没有很大的电流输出。这也就是很早以前讨论过的,口可以直接接地,但不能直接接电源的缘故。(扩展芯片不包括在内)
 楼主| haysion 发表于 2007-9-13 17:17 | 显示全部楼层

谢谢各位


    对P0口结构不了解,我在看P0的结构图时,输出高电平,Vcc不是通过MOS管直接导通到地了吗?
    D:P0
 楼主| haysion 发表于 2007-9-18 08:35 | 显示全部楼层

弄懂了……

昨天看了单片机的基础书,上网看了看,原来知道输出时上拉的MOS管是截止的,谢谢各位了
gyt 发表于 2007-9-18 09:18 | 显示全部楼层

不是51吧?

51的P0口根本没有上拉
_horse 发表于 2007-9-18 20:06 | 显示全部楼层

???????

输出时上拉的MOS管是截止的???
NE5532 发表于 2007-9-18 20:09 | 显示全部楼层

看来还是没搞清楚。

您需要登录后才可以回帖 登录 | 注册

本版积分规则

7

主题

25

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部